North Dakota Distracted Driving Laws and Penalties

North Dakota has implemented stringent distracted driving laws to enhance road safety. The primary focus is on preventing activities that take a driver’s attention away from the road, with texting while driving being a significant concern. The state’s legislation prohibits using a mobile device for text messaging or electronic communication while operating a vehicle. Violators face substantial fines, which can range from $100 to $350, depending on the severity of the offense and any prior convictions. These penalties aim to deter drivers from engaging in behaviors that compromise safety.

A Do Not Text Lawyer North Dakota specializes in defending clients against charges related to texting while driving. They understand the nuances of the state’s laws and can effectively challenge the evidence presented by law enforcement. For instance, these lawyers may argue that a police officer’s observation was inconsistent or that text messages were misinterpreted. By employing legal tactics such as motion to suppress evidence or negotiating plea deals, they aim to minimize the penalties associated with violations.
Practical advice for individuals charged includes promptly retaining legal counsel and providing complete cooperation during the legal process. It’s essential to remember that a conviction can lead to substantial fines, license suspension, and potential insurance rate increases.
